What on earth is an Artisan Gallery?
At its core, an artisan gallery is actually a curated Area that showcases and sells handcrafted do the job made by competent artisans. These works generally reflect cultural traditions, regional products, and personalised methods. Compared with standard artwork galleries that emphasis solely on wonderful artwork (like paintings or sculpture), artisan galleries span an array of media including:

Textiles and fiber art

Pottery and ceramics

Woodcraft and home furnishings

Jewelry and metalwork

Glass artwork

Leather items

Handmade paper and calligraphy

Baskets, devices, and folk art

Each bit tells a story—not simply of aesthetics, but of heritage, labor, product, and human emotion.

Artisan Galleries Around the globe
Enable’s check out a few noteworthy artisan galleries that have manufactured an impact:

one. Santa Fe, New Mexico, USA
Household to a flourishing artisan scene, Santa Fe is known for its Native American and Southwestern arts. The Museum of Intercontinental Folk Artwork and Canyon Road galleries are have to-visits for collectors and cultural explorers.

two. Kyoto, Japan
From standard kimono weaving to lacquerware, Kyoto’s artisan galleries emphasize the refined craftsmanship of Japanese culture. Nishijin Textile Heart and unbiased artisan studios are well-known Places.

3. Oaxaca, Mexico
Famed for its lively textiles, pottery, and alebrijes (folks artwork sculptures), Oaxaca’s artisan galleries are frequently spouse and children-owned and deeply rooted in Zapotec and Mixtec traditions.

4. Marrakesh, Morocco
A haven for artisan enthusiasts, Marrakesh’s souks and galleries give hand-knotted rugs, brass lamps, leather items, plus much more. Boutique galleries in the medina curate the finest picks.

five. Florence, Italy
Florence is not just the home of Renaissance art—What's more, it has a thriving artisan Neighborhood, particularly in leatherwork, paper marbling, and goldsmithing. The Oltrarno district is usually a hidden gem.
